On Mon, Nov 09, 2015 at 03:20:24PM +0000, Phil Edworthy wrote:
> cc'ing others (Tegra, Altera, Designware) who may have the same bug
> 
> On 03 November 2015 09:28, Phil Edworthy wrote:
> > The OF node passed to irq_domain_add_linear() should be a
> > pointer to interrupt controller's device tree node, or NULL,
> > but not the PCI controller's node.
> > 
> > This fixes an oops in msi_domain_alloc_irqs() when it tries
> > to call msi_check().
> >

On Tegra the PCI controller is in fact the interrupt controller for
MSIs. And looking at the code here it seems like the same would apply to
RCAR.

I'm also slightly confused as to why this would cause ->msi_check() to
fail. The default implementation (msi_domain_ops_check()) doesn't do
anything.

Also, how is passing in NULL instead of a valid struct device_node *
going to prevent an oops? Perhaps this is one of those reference count
imbalance bugs that have recently been showing up?
